Transaction f24028c266222c1cd4424c36d8ad93bedb14db226782c3beca96d62db682cfd3
1 Input
1 Output
-
f24028c266222c1cd4424c36d8ad93bedb14db226782c3beca96d62db682cfd3:0
- value
- 20626878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f0e58addc58b7846d8ebc247b33a521a8358738 OP_EQUAL
- address
- 3BpE7eDZ643yDo6oDuQc94FcYvVibc9TvS